Shikamaru
Full name: Nara Shikamaru
Affiliation: Konoha
Age: 14
Gender: Male
Power Rank: C
Signature Abilities: Kage Mane no Jutsu
     Shikamaru is lazy. He hates fighting, hates training, and would rather just lay back and look at the clouds, or play a nice game of chess than get involved in any kind of trouble. Unfortunatly for him, he also has a strong sense of duty, and whenever he is needed, he goes along without hesitation, although with plenty of complaining about "how troublesome" it all is. You see, for despite being lazy, Shikamaru is a genius. He had terrible scores in the Academy, because he slept through all the tests, but an IQ test disguised as a game (since he wouldn't have been interested in taking it otherwise) showed that he had an IQ of over 200 (which is the highest the scale goes). Shikamaru is a brilliant tactician, able to formulate hundreds of scenarios in seconds in his mind and choose the correct one for any given situation. He's not a very good hand-to-hand fighter, but his mind more than makes up for it, which is why he was the only one made a Chuunin after the first exam he participated in. Many a foe have underestimated him and found themselves dancing to the strings of one of his complex plans, and finally snared in his ultimate trap.
        That trap often comes in the form of his family's secret technique, Kage Mane no Jutsu, or the Shadow Bind. Shikamaru is able to control his shadow, making it stretch out and contort. If it touches someone else's shadow, he is able to bind that person to him, so they are frozen in place and must mimic every move he makes. This is a great way to immobalize enemies and force them into his traps. He is know also trained in the next step in shadow control, the Shadow Choke, where he can actually strangle his enemies with their own shadow once he catches them in the Bind, making him more deadly than he was before. Although he lacks in raw power, Shikamaru is a valued planner and thinker for Konoha. He is also one of Naruto's best friends, as the two had a fair bit of slacking in common at the Academy. His best from from childhood, however, has been Chouji, who is also his teammate.
